Sammy Okposo acquitted in Aberdeen

The Aberdeen Sheriff Court in Scotland has reportedly discharged gospel artiste, Sammy Okposo, in a case bordering on racially aggravating behaviours during an infraction that occured at a Chinese restaurant, Jimmy Chung's, at the Aberdeen Beach Esplanade, Scotland, last July. According to a statement from the singer's publicists, "Okposo was discharged and acquitted of all charges on April 8 at exactly 11:30am by the presiding judge who said the evidences brought against Sammy are insufficient, incoherent and baseless. The most surprising aspect of the court proceedings was that Okposo wasn't called upon at any time by the judge to step into the witness box. The judge pronounced his judgement after Okposo's lawyer, Ms Val Bremmer from Mackie and Dewar Solicitors, cross examined the manager and the assistant manager of Jimmy Chung's and discovered that their testimonies were incoherent."

Okposo was honeymooning with his wife in Aberdeen when he was arrested after he got into an argument with one of the attendants at Jimmy Chung's which operates an all-you-can-eat menu. He was supposed to appear in court last September for the first hearing but E-Punch could not ascertain whether he did. This acquittal is happening about two weeks to the commencement of Okposo's Out Of Africa, North American 2011 Tour.
